Highlands Natural Resources Signs DT Ultravert Licence Agreement

Mon, 23rd May 2016 08:17

LONDON (Alliance News) - Shares in Highlands Natural Resources PLC were up on Monday, after it said it has signed a licence agreement for the use of its DT Ultravert re-fracking technology with pressure-pumping provider Calfrac Well Services Corp.

Shares in Highlands Natural Resources were up 24% at 51.60 pence on Monday morning, having touched a high of 57.00p earlier, near to the stock's 52-week high of 58.50p.

Last year, Highlands bought a 75% interest in fracking technology DT Ultravert from Diversion Technologies. Highlands said on Monday that Calfrac has licensed the DT Ultravert technology on a shared exclusivity basis for use in connection with its commercial hydraulic fracturing operations, activities and services in seven US states.

The licence agreement has an initial term of two years, Highlands said, and will then automatically renew for consecutive one-year periods, unless terminated.

Highlands said it also has the exclusive right to market nitrogen gas to Calfrac at current market rates for all fracking operations using the DT Ultravert technology throughout the term of the licence agreement.

Calfrac said it will provide data to Highlands and Diversion which may be used to further develop the re-fracking technology, and both companies are entitled to a 2.0% royalty based on the revenue received by Calfrac from each operation using the technology during the term of the agreement, Highlands said.

"We are delighted to have entered into another licence agreement with a highly reputable oilfield services provider in the US and Canada," said Highlands Chief Executive Robert Price.

"Together with our agreement with Schlumberger NV, these agreements will help accelerate the market penetration, commercialisation and industry adoption of DT Ultravert, a technology we believe has the potential to transform and significantly reduce the costs associated with unconventional exploration and production via re-fracking using a diverter technology, particularly in the current oil price environment," Price added.
